Web20 apr. 2024 · The new evidence that establishes human activity in Ireland 33,000 years ago was discovered in 1972 at Castlepook Cave near Doneraile in north Cork, and it comes in the form of a bone fragment from the hind leg reindeer femur. This finding resets the clock on currently maintained population models of western Europe by more than 20,000 years. The Upper Paleolithic (or Upper Palaeolithic) is the third and last subdivision of the Paleolithic or Old Stone Age.
